Delivery Driver Jobs in Rhode Island
A Delivery Driver in the transportation industry is responsible for transporting goods from distribution centers to businesses, residences or other designated locations. They are in charge of ensuring that deliveries are made in a timely manner, keeping accurate records of deliveries, and providing excellent customer service to customers or clients. They generally load and unload goods, inspect and maintain the delivery vehicle, follow driving regulations and safety standards. Additionally, they might be required to report any incidents they encounter while making a delivery to a supervisor.
Before becoming a Delivery Driver, one might have roles such as a Warehouse Associate, where they would gain experience in handling goods, or a Customer Service Representative, where they would learn how to interact with clients effectively. In terms of skills, Delivery Drivers should have excellent driving skills, physical stamina, time management skills, customer service skills, and the ability to work independently. They should also be detail-oriented to maintain accurate records. They should possess a valid driver's license, and in some cases, they may need special certifications depending on what they are transporting - for instance, a Commercial Driver's License (CDL) for transporting large quantities of goods or hazardous materials.
